  1. Jerry Portnoy was born in Chicago in 1943, and literally grew up with The Blues all around him. His father had a store on Maxwell Street Market and young harp players like Little Walter and ‘Shakey’ Horton could be heard outside playing for tips in the biggest melting-pot for creative Blues the world has ever seen.   5. 1 de may. de 2002 · Jerry Portnoy inhabited the harmonica chair in Muddy Waters' band, replacing Mojo Buford in 1976. Portnoy went on from there to form The Legendary Blues Band with Pinetop Perkins. In the mid-'80s Portnoy left the Legendary Blues Band and retired for a short time only to come back and help found Ronnie Earl and the Broadcasters.

  7. Jerry Portnoy discovered the harmonica at a friend’s house sitting on a mantle.He’d faltered trying to learn instruments that required his hands but something about the instrument spoke to him. Portnoy quickly became obsessed and, in the forthcoming decades, backed up some of the greatest blues musicians to ever live like Muddy Waters and Eric Clapton.
